Mathematical Derivation and Examples

  • Date Arithmetic Algorithms
  • Timezone Conversion Methods
  • Precision Calculation Techniques
The mathematical foundation of countdown calculations involves complex date arithmetic, timezone conversions, and precision handling. Understanding these algorithms helps users appreciate the accuracy of the calculator and troubleshoot any issues that may arise.
Date Difference Calculation Algorithm
The core algorithm converts both dates to Unix timestamps (seconds since January 1, 1970), calculates the difference, and converts the result to human-readable units. This method handles leap years, varying month lengths, and calendar anomalies automatically. The formula: Time Difference = Target Timestamp - Start Timestamp.
Timezone Conversion and UTC Handling
Timezone conversions use standardized timezone databases to calculate offset differences. The calculator converts local times to UTC for calculations, then converts results back to the user's timezone. This ensures accuracy across international date lines and daylight saving time changes.
